Here’s another one of our seamstresses…. I call her the Energizer Bunny. She has more energy than I think I have ever had.

“My name is Jerri Schiffmann, mother of two girls, grandmother of two grandsons. One lives in Georgia, one lives in Florida.
I am a transplant from Georgia and have been in Florida since 2014.
I am retired now and am 71 years young/old!

I started to learn to sew from my grandmother. Then when she passed, my mom showed me. I started the basics…,apron, dish towels.
In high school I took Home Economics and furthered my sewing expectations. Then I just went on my own, sewing what I wanted to sew whether for myself or family.
My oldest daughter told me about Cindy and told me what she was doing. I contacted Cindy in March and have been sewing for her since that time.
I love sewing for this non profit organization. I, and the other ladies sew from the love in our hearts and the love that others will receive from these gifts. It is fun but it makes my heart feel good to know that we are helping others in their time of need.”

We love having you as a part of us Jerri! Thank you for your hard work!~ Cindy

Get to know our seamstresses:
I'm going to start off with Jean Kendall, mom of our board member Mark Kendall. I'd never met Jean before January, but I feel like we've been lifelong friends. Here's a sweet note from Jean.

"Just a few words about what Sew Love means to me. I grew up in Phoenix, Arizona with loving parents and two sisters. My father was a carpenter - a hands on man who worked hard and made nice things for our home too. My mother kept our home and taught us at a young age to sew and cook. She also encouraged us musically - so I have played violin all my life. After college I worked as a nurse and met my husband Floyd at seminary in Ft. Worth, Texas. After graduation he pastored churches in New Mexico and Colorado. Then we had the opportunity to serve in SE Asia as missionaries planting new churches. We moved to Bangkok, Thailand with our 4 year old son Mark and our son Jason was born there. We also served in Seoul, Korea. After 11 years we moved back to Colorado. All along the way my sewing machine was a helpful companion. Our boys graduated college, married and now have families and carreers of their own. Floyd and I retired 11 years ago and moved here to Melbourne. We loved playing in our church orchestra - Floyd played French horn. Five years ago Floyd passed away and life has been a new and different journey. But God has been faithful and given me opportunities to serve in my church and the community. Then covid came along and many outside groups were shut down. I was praying and seeking what to do. Then last January I learned about Sew Love from my son Mark who serves on the Board. I was over joyed. Cindy has been so gracious in letting me be a small part. I love sewing all the items that bring joy, a "hug" and encouragement to all who receive them."........we feel so blessed to have you with us Jean. ~ Cindy
